Ten Things I Wish I'd Known Before I Went Out into the Real World is a book by Maria Shriver, published in 2000. It evolved from her commencement address at College of the Holy Cross, during which she said "Ten Things I Wish Someone had told me at Graduation Before I Went Out in the World". They are elaborated in her book:
First and Foremost: Pinpoint Your Passion
No Job Is Beneath You
Who You Work for and with Is as Important as What You Do
Your Behavior Has Consequences
Be Willing to Fail
Superwoman is Dead
Children Do Change Your Career
Marriage is a Hell of a Lot of Hard Work
Don't Expect Anyone Else to Support You Financially
Laughter
